Prof. Ali Ahmad Celebrates Toyin Saraki's 60th, Hails Her Advocacy for Maternal Health

Date: 2024-09-07

According to the news report from This Day, the former Speaker of the Kwara State House of Assembly and Professor of Constitutional Law, Prof. Ali Ahmad, has praised Mrs. Oluwatoyin Saraki, the former First Lady of Kwara State and Founder of the Wellbeing Foundation Africa, for her tireless advocacy for the well-being of mothers and children.

In a statement personally signed by Prof. Ahmad on Friday, titled “Barrister Toyin Saraki@60: Celebrating a Life of Impact and Service,” he extended heartfelt wishes to Mrs. Saraki on her 60th birthday, acknowledging her significant contributions to maternal and child health.

Prof. Ahmad also highlighted the influential roles played by the Ojora and Saraki families in shaping Mrs. Saraki's character and leadership. He commended her relentless dedication to critical causes and lauded her accomplishments through the Wellbeing Foundation Africa, which he described as a reflection of her compassion and resilience.

While expressing great joy, on behalf of himself and his family, in celebrating Barrister Saraki, the former speaker recognized her as a powerful advocate for the voiceless and a source of hope for many individuals across Africa.

The statement partly reads, “On behalf of my family and myself, I, Professor Ali Ahmad, former Speaker of the Kwara State House of Assembly, take great pleasure in celebrating Her Excellency, Barrister Oluwatoyin Saraki, former First Lady of Kwara State and Founder of the Wellbeing Foundation Africa, on the joyous occasion of her 60th birthday today, September 6, 2024.

“Your life's work, particularly through the Wellbeing Foundation Africa, is an affiliation to the compassion and resilience that are the hallmarks of both your esteemed family backgrounds.

“You have emerged as a powerful voice for the voiceless, a protector of mothers and children, and a beacon of hope for countless individuals across Africa.

“The harmony between the noble traditions of the Ojora family and the unwavering dedication of the Saraki family has shaped you into a leader who tirelessly champions the causes that matter most.”

The former speaker commended the former first lady's commitment as a lawyer, philanthropist, and health and wellness advocate, as well as her philanthropic efforts and passion for cycling, which continue to set a standard for others.

He prayed the Almighty to continue showering her with blessings, good health, happiness, and prosperity as she celebrates her 60th birthday.

“As a lawyer, philanthropist, and dedicated advocate for health and wellness, your unwavering commitment to the betterment of society, especially the younger generation, is nothing short of inspiring.

“Your passion for cycling and your philanthropic endeavors continue to set a standard for all of us.

“You have touched countless lives with your grace, humility, and relentless pursuit of excellence. May the Almighty continue to shower you with His blessings, granting you many more years filled with good health, happiness, and prosperity”.
